Integrated morphometric and machine learning-based flood risk assessment in the Rangit river sub-watersheds, Eastern Himalayas
This study analyzed the Rangit River Basin's morphometry to assess flood risk. Six sub-watersheds (SW1-SW6) were prioritized via morphometric parameters. SW1, SW4, and SW5 are high priority. A Random Forest ML model (24 variables) created a flood risk map. The results aid flood mitigation efforts.

Understanding Wing Dams and Their Role in Flood Risk
Wing dams improve navigation, but their impact on water levels and flood risk has long been debated. By combining detailed 3D and large-scale 1D models, we uncover how different riverbed types shape long-term water level responses to these structures.
Human Activities and Climate Disturbances Are Accelerating the Release of the World’s Largest Ocean Mercury Sink
First quantification of the continental shelf’s capacity to sequester the toxic heavy metal mercury reveals it stores six times more than previously known, but human activities and climate disturbances may reverse its role into a source of marine pollution
A Groundwater Well Database for Brazil
In collaboration with the Geological Survey of Brazil, we present the GWDBrazil, which consolidates and standardizes information from over 351,000 wells. This dataset is intended to provide essential information to support comprehensive water management strategies in Brazil.
Farmer awareness of heavy metal contamination in urban roadside vegetables along the Accra–Tema motorway, Ghana
This study examines farmers’ awareness of heavy metal contamination in vegetables grown along Ghana’s Accra–Tema motorway. It highlights the health risks of roadside farming, the lack of knowledge among farmers, and calls for education and policies to promote safer urban agriculture
A comprehensive review of emerging environmental contaminants of global concern
Emerging contaminants like plastics, pharmaceuticals, PFAS, and endocrine disruptors are increasingly found in water, soil, and food. Often unregulated, they threaten ecosystems and health. This review explores their sources, impacts, and detection methods to guide global solutions.
